Google Unveils First Official Look at Pixel 10 Pro Fold

Google's next Pixel launch event is just around the corner, scheduled for next week. However, the company has already given us a sneak peek at the Pixel 10 Pro Fold with a brief video teaser released on Tuesday. The teaser suggests the new foldable will look quite similar to its predecessor, the Pixel 9 Pro Fold. This aligns with earlier leaks about the device's design.
The 30-second preview offers a few shadowy shots of the phone, a quick look at its unfolded inner screen, and a clear view of the back, highlighting the camera setup. It also confirms the device will be available in the attractive gray color Google previously showcased in a Pixel 10 teaser.
While the video doesn't reveal any technical specifications, rumors point to an IP68 rating for dust and water resistance. Leaked images have also shown the phone in green and gold color options not featured in this teaser. Although the video description notes the August 20th event date, it doesn't specify a release window. A report from WinFuture suggests the phone might not hit the market until October.
The good news is, with Google's event less than two weeks away, we won't have to wait much longer for all the official details.
